Ludovic Courtès schreef op za 12-02-2022 om 22:45 [+0100]:
> + (add-before 'configure 'remove-bundled-texinfo
> + (lambda _
> + ;; Do not build the bundled Texinfo.
> + (delete-file-recursively "texinfo")
Unbundling seems more something for a source snippet to me,
since it's ‘cleaning up’ the source code. ‘(guix)Snipppets versus
Phases’ also says:
The boundary between using an origin snippet versus a build phase to
modify the sources of a package can be elusive. Origin snippets are
typically used to remove unwanted files such as bundled libraries,
[...]
